Twenty at the Tower Releases A Few More Tickets to July 22 Pop-Up Dinner to Benefit Fort Worth Food & Wine Festival


A few seats just opened up for next Monday night’s Twenty at the Tower pop-op dinner, the cool Fort Worth Food & Wine Festival fundraiser that brings a different surprise chef (& surprise menu) 2 nights a week for 10 weeks to the Tower building in cowtown (20 nights, get it?).

Five more pairs of tickets just opened up for July 22– I can’t reveal the chef, but if you like Uchi, you’ll want in on this guy’s East-meets-Southwest style of cooking.

I attended Bolsa’s dinner last Monday (and FT33’s the week before) and had a blast. And I love that it’s BYOB. Remember the Dallas pop-up “48 Nights” a few years ago? This is just as cool.
